Video Tutorial – Tips & Tricks: The Weaver’s Knot

The Weaver’s Knot is a great way to avoid having to sew loose ends into your beadwork. It’s perfect to use with Peyote stitch and Netting if your seed beads aren’t too small and the thread is fine enough. I wouldn’t use the Weaver’s Knot for Brick Stitch, Right Angle Weave, Herringbone or Square Stitch, because of the number of passes you have to make through the beads. The Weaver’s Knot works great with Nymo but isn’t as successful with Fireline because of the waxy coating – it slides!
